Chemical Information
Catalog NumB16709
M. Wt268.27
FormulaC13H16O6
Purity>98%
Storageat -20 °C 3 years (powder form); at -20 °C 6 months (Solution base)
CAS No.170031-43-3
Synonyms
SMILESO=C(O)C1=CC=C2OCCOCCOCCOC2=C1
